What causes packaging waste and shipping delays in the first place?
Before picking vendors, fix the roots. Tools amplify discipline; they never create it.
- Approval sprawl: Artwork and label copy move through five approvers with no SLA. Design sits. Press time vanishes. Ops eats the delay with overtime or holds. Mechanism: no one owns final sign-off authority, so risk aversion adds reviewers.
- SKU proliferation vs. MOQ: Marketing pushes micro-variants; Procurement chases lower unit prices with bigger runs. Result: pallets of obsolete cartons when specs change. Incentive clash: unit price looks good on a spreadsheet; write-offs land months later on Ops.
- Data ownership vacuum: No clear owner for case label templates, GS1-128 content, or hazard statements. Threshold: once you cross a few hundred SKUs or multiple ship-to regions, unmanaged templates drift and break.
- WMS/ERP integration gaps: Labeling relies on manual exports or brittle drivers. When APIs lag or drivers change, label content desyncs from orders. Failure mode: relabeling queues and line stoppages within hours.
- Sustainability without performance criteria: Recyclable materials chosen without humidity, chill-chain, or abrasion testing. Mechanism: ESG gets the metric, Ops gets the returns and damage claims.
- No pilot at line speed: Press proofs approved in a conference room. Real issues appear only when labels meet dust, heat, or cold conveyors at 30 cases per minute.

Which mechanisms actually create or prevent cost creep?
Here’s where behavior shifts margin. Not features: mechanisms.
Substrate and adhesive choice either reduces rework or guarantees it
Mechanism: material compatibility with environment. Freezer-grade adhesive and topcoat that resists condensation prevent peel-offs in cold chain. Without it, labels fail during tempering and you’re hand-relabeling at the dock. Threshold: any shipment below 40°F or above 90°F for sustained periods. Incentive distortion: Procurement sees a cheaper paper; Ops sees a second shift of relabel labor.
Printing method changes inventory risk and lead-time speed
Digital short-runs reduce obsolescence and speed approvals but carry higher per-unit price. Flexo or litho offers beautiful, consistent large runs but locks you into MOQs and longer changeovers. On-demand thermal transfer shifts cost to blank stock and ribbon but collapses lead time. Trade-off: unit price vs. working capital vs. agility. Failure mode: overcommitting to bulk print in a fast-changing spec environment creates write-offs.
Variable data control is either an engine or a grenade
Case labels, SSCC, batch/lot, and GHS details depend on clean data and template control. Ownership gap means templates fork and hardcoded text lingers. Threshold: multiple plants or co-packers. Failure mode: duplicate SSCCs or mismatched GS1 application identifiers that stop receiving dead.
Color and brand fidelity can fight scanability if unmanaged
Marketing pushes dense gradients and high coverage; Operations needs quiet zones and contrast for scanners. Mechanism: black-on-white with proper x-dimension scans; reverse-outs overprint poorly on some substrates. Control function: brand systems that specify when readability overrides aesthetic. Incentive tension: brand team measured on fidelity, Ops on throughput.
Regulatory content expands copy and shrinks legibility
GHS, Prop 65, and multi-language requirements inflate font counts. Mechanism: fixed label real estate; adding copy reduces minimum font sizes and increases error risk. Threshold: exports or hazardous materials. Solution path: information architecture, treat labels like a mini decision engine: hierarchy, iconography, and scannable zones. Department metrics pull in different directions unless controlled
- Marketing: measured on brand fidelity and client sentiment: tends to favor rich print and custom dielines.
- Operations: measured on picks per hour and ship-complete-on-time: favors simple, scannable, standardized materials.
- Procurement: measured on unit price and MOQs: concentrates spend, extends runs, inflates obsolescence exposure.
- Quality/Regulatory: measured on compliance escapes: adds reviewers and slows cycles when decision rights aren’t tight.
- Finance: measured on working capital: wants lower inventory, but often sees only unit price at award time.
Without defined operating rules, the loudest department wins the day and the dock pays tomorrow.
What are the real trade-offs when you pick methods and partners?
| Method/Choice | Increases | Reduces | Requires | Risk if Mismanaged |
|---|---|---|---|---|
| Digital short-run cartons/labels | Agility; rapid spec changes | Obsolescence; lead time | Tight art/approval cadence | Per-unit creep without volume controls |
| Flexo/litho bulk print | Brand consistency; unit price wins | Agility; working capital | Stable specs; forecast discipline | Write-offs when SKUs shift |
| On-demand thermal transfer | Speed; variable data accuracy | Preprint dependency | Printer upkeep; data control | Template drift; printer downtime |
| Preprinted shells + overprint | Brand fidelity; flexibility | Full-bleed limitations | Shell inventory control | Mismatch between shell and overprint |
| Single primary agency partner | Systemization; accountability | Bid use | SLA rigor; exit triggers | Complacency without audits |
| Multi-vendor portfolio | Redundancy; price tension | Simplicity; brand control | Template control; QA burden | Data fragmentation; version errors |
Where does this break in the real world?
Failure is predictable. Here are the ones that actually happen on real docks and lines.
Template drift and duplicate SSCCs
Mechanism: a well-meaning supervisor clones a label template for a rush job, hardcodes a field, and forgets to retire it. Later, two printers call the same counter. Receiving halts when duplicate SSCCs hit the 3PL. Threshold: multiple printers or locations without central template control.
Printer-driver “minor” updates
IT patches drivers on Friday. On Monday, label heights clip by 2mm. The scanner misses the last digits; pickers handwrite corrections until someone notices. Implementation friction: no dev/test/prod path for print drivers. Control gap, not technology magic.
Adhesive and topcoat mismatch
Marketing approved a gorgeous matte finish on a label that rides chilled totes. Condensation turns matte into mush. Relabeling begins. No humidity chamber test was run. A ten-minute environmental test would have saved a week of overtime.
GHS and multilingual crowd-out
Four languages, hazard icons, and QR codes get crammed into the same real estate. Font drops below readable size. Compliance is technically present; practically invisible. Audit fails. Product holds at customs. The mechanism: too many requirements, no information hierarchy.
Quiet zone violations from “creative” background patterns
A subtle pattern encroaches on barcode quiet zones by 1–2mm. Verification fails sporadically on older scanners. The QA sample passed on a brand-new gun; the floor runs with mixed hardware. Failure threshold: heterogeneous scanner fleet.
Cold-chain tape and label failures
Freezer-grade tape wasn’t actually freezer-grade; it was “cold-tolerant” in a lab. Pallet corners peel during tempering. Stretch wrap hides label corners. Carriers reject or re-class. Cause: spec sheet reading vs. pilot at operating temps and times.
Artwork version confusion
Three PDFs named “final” sit in a shared folder. The press runs the wrong one. You get 20,000 perfect cartons with last month’s certification mark. That’s not a vendor failure: that’s version control without a single source of truth.
Variable data field mapping errors
During ERP upgrades, application identifiers in the GS1-128 template change sequence. The label still prints; the content is nonsense. Scanners reject pallets. No one documented the mapping during the last implementation. Dashboards won’t save you here.
Physical line reality vs. conference-room approvals
Everything looked fine on a glossy press proof. Then the label peeler at Line 2 jams every third roll because the gap sensor doesn’t like the new substrate. It’s the sixth jam and someone finally checks spec sheets. Line speed isn’t a design critique; it’s a constraint.
Procurement’s unit price win becomes Ops’ overtime bill
Bulk carton order saved pennies per unit. Three months later, new client requires extra side-markings. Old stock becomes scrap or rework. The savings were imaginary; carrying costs and rework minutes were real. Incentive misfire created by siloed metrics.

What operating controls actually keep this in check?
Control system = decision rights + risk allocation + enforcement. Not a meeting. A system.
Commercial (external agency/vendor)
- Rate and run model: Separate design from production economics. Pay for design systems and templates once; price production by run type (digital, flexo, on-demand) with clear MOQs and setup time disclosures.
- Risk allocation: Define who absorbs obsolescence when specs change post-approval and stock exists. Tie to approval timestamps, not emails.
- Penalty/incentive: Tie on-time proof and on-time delivery to service credits; attach expedited freight liability to the party that misses the committed gate.
- Exit/renegotiation triggers: Material defect rates or verification fails beyond a set threshold over a defined period trigger a business review. Keep it objective.
Operational (internal ownership)
- Data ownership: The Central Data Authority (named role) owns label templates and GS1 application identifier mapping. When variance exceeds a defined fail rate on verification, they must fix within 24–48 hours.
- Approval authority: One documented final approver for artwork and one for regulatory content. If both aren’t the same person, sequence them. Deadline SLA enforced.
- Exception workflow: When a print failure occurs, Ops owns the immediate workaround decision (relabel, hold, or reprint). QA owns the root cause within 72 hours. Finance logs exposure as working-capital or margin hit.
- Template change control: No edits without ticket, test print, and sign-off. Keep dev/test/prod queues for drivers and templates: no direct-to-production changes.
Strategic (capacity and resilience)
- Capacity modeling: Keep at least two output paths for critical labels: on-demand internal and external preprint. Exercise the backup monthly.
- Joint investment: Where volume justifies, co-invest in dies, plates, or verification equipment with your primary partner: include portability terms.
- Standardization policy: Limit unique dielines and finishes. Cap the count unless Marketing presents a commercial rationale tied to revenue or client retention.
Ownership clarity matters more than cadence. Without it, the same arguments repeat and the dock pays twice.

Frequently Asked Questions
How do I know if we need a specialized print design agency or just a printer?
If late ships, relabeling, or inventory write-offs keep repeating, you need more than press time. A specialized agency will redesign the label and packaging system around your workflows and data, not just deliver files. The threshold is usually crossed when you have multiple plants, a 3PL, exports, or regulated products. At that point, operating controls and integration outweigh per-unit price.
What should be in the first 90 days of an engagement?
Insist on a discovery of SKU taxonomy, label templates, environmental constraints, and printer fleet. Then a pilot at line speed with verification data, not just proofs. Lock decision rights and SLAs. Finally, a phased cutover plan with rollback paths and a template control playbook. If you don’t see those artifacts, you’re buying production, not control.
How do we balance sustainability goals with durability and compliance?
Write pass/fail performance criteria first: temp/humidity ranges, abrasion cycles, and scanner verification scores. Then evaluate recyclable or compostable substrates that meet those thresholds. Sustainability that triggers rework or damage claims is not progress; it’s cost shifted downstream. Pilot under real conditions before scaling.
What KPIs actually indicate improvement beyond unit price?
Watch verification pass rate, rework minutes per thousand units, dock-to-ship time, obsolete packaging write-offs, and carrier claim frequency. Tie improvements to specific design or control changes. When these trend the right way consistently, the program is actually working. Unit price alone is a decoy.
How many vendors should we keep?
Typically, one primary agency for system ownership and one to two secondary producers for redundancy. Keep templates centralized to prevent data drift. Concentration improves consistency and accountability; a thin portfolio maintains resilience. The wrong number is “many” with no template control, or “one” with no exit triggers.
Who should own label templates and changes internally?
Appoint a Central Data Authority, often within Operations or IT, with final ownership of templates and mappings. Marketing owns brand assets; QA owns regulatory copy; Procurement owns commercial terms. Change requests route through the Authority with test prints and documented approvals. Without this, template drift is inevitable.
Build a vendor scorecard you can defend
Align selection criteria to the outcomes you care about: reduced waste, faster time‑to‑ship, fewer compliance incidents, and predictable total cost. Weight each criterion 1–5 based on your priorities, then ask every contender to substantiate with artifacts (samples, SOPs, logs, references).
- Carrier and GS1 compliance: Ability to design and validate SSCC‑18, GS1‑128, ITF‑14, and last‑mile labels (UPS, FedEx, DHL, USPS) with machine‑readable QA reports.
- DFM/DFP rigor: Proven methods to reduce inks, plates, and substrate waste; evidence of size and layout optimization that cuts material yield by 3–10%.
- Prepress automation: Template engines, data mappings (ZPL/EPL/Bartender/NiceLabel), and scripted checks for barcodes, quiet zones, and brand color deltas.
- Print process versatility: Digital, flexo, litho, and thermal transfer proficiency with clear decision rules for when to use each based on volumes and SKU complexity.
- Material science: Adhesive and substrate recommendations by environment (cold chain, dusty DCs, humidity, outdoor exposure) with sample aging tests.
- Color management: ICC profiles, device link workflows, Delta E tolerances, and a plan to hit brand colors on kraft and recycled stocks.
- Integration depth: ERP/WMS/TMS connectors, label data control, and audit trails that satisfy internal controls and customer audits.
- Change control: Versioning, approvals, traceability, and rollback procedures with time‑stamped proofs and print logs.
- Sustainability and EPR readiness: Design choices that reduce inks/plates, increase recycled content, and support current/future labeling regulations.
- Program management: Dedicated PMO, SLAs, implementation playbooks, and multi‑site rollout experience.
- Commercial transparency: Clear rate cards, pass‑through policies, and a TCO model that stands up in Finance.

Understand pricing and total cost of ownership
A credible partner will help model TCO beyond the hourly rate. Expect transparency across these buckets:
- Discovery and audit: Facility walks, artifact review, barcode verifications, and SKU rationalization.
- Template engineering: Dielines, variable data mappings, color profiles, and validated proofs.
- Workflow tools: Label management, DAM, proofing, and approval platforms (licenses, hosting, support).
- Integration: Connectors, middleware, testing, and documentation.
- Change control: Ongoing versioning, regulatory updates, and control checkpoints.
- Prototyping and test prints: On‑press trials, lab testing, and sample logistics.
- Training and enablement: SOPs, printer calibration playbooks, and user training.
- Ongoing services: Quarterly business reviews, template health checks, and analytics.
Cost‑down levers a strong print design agency specializing in shipping and logistics should quantify upfront:
- Material yield: Size reductions, margin trims, and gang‑run strategies.
- Ink/plate economy: Spot color rationalization, screen angles, and expanded gamut.
- Process shifts: Digital for short runs/versions, flexo for stable high‑volume SKUs.
- Version consolidation: Variable data to collapse SKUs across regions and customers.
- Carrier compliance: Fewer chargebacks and reprints through verifier‑led QA.
- Printer fleet optimization: Standard ribbons, media, and maintenance schedules.
90–120 day rollout roadmap
- Days 0–15: Discovery and current‑state mapping. Collect top 80% of volume SKUs, carrier specs, printer inventory, and failure modes. Stand up project controls.
- Days 16–45: Engineering sprints. Create master dielines, variable data templates, and color profiles. Build integration mappings and a sandbox environment.
- Days 46–70: Pilot. Select 1–2 plants and 20–50 high‑velocity SKUs. Run test prints, verifier scans, and environmental tests. Capture cycle times and spoilage.
- Days 71–90: Iterate and harden. Address exceptions, finalize SOPs, train local superusers, and prepare go/no‑go criteria.
- Days 91–120: Scale. Roll out to remaining sites in waves. Monitor KPIs daily for two weeks per site, then move to weekly cadence.
KPIs that prove the program is working
- Art‑to‑press lead time: Target 30–50% reduction vs. baseline.
- Cost per thousand (CPT) labels: Track by lane, substrate, and process.
- Material utilization: Substrate yield improvement and ink coverage reduction.
- Spoilage and reprint rate: DPPM tied to misprints, failed scans, and damage.
- Compliance incidents: Carrier chargebacks, GS1 verifier fails, and customer refusals.
- Change cycle time: Request to approved template, with audit trail completeness.
- On‑time ship: Correlation between label availability/accuracy and cut‑off adherence.
- Supplier performance: SLA attainment on proofs, changes, and issue resolution.

When in‑house is the right answer
If you have stable SKUs, low regulatory churn, and a mature label management stack, in‑house may be cheaper. Keep an agency on retainer for spikes, carrier changes, and optimization sprints. Conversely, high SKU velocity, multi‑plant complexity, and frequent compliance shifts are strong signals to engage a specialist.
